Sule kuulutus

iOS operatsioonisüsteemi iseloomustab eelkõige selle lihtsus ja väledus. Tänu suurepärasele riist- ja tarkvara integratsioonile on Apple suutnud optimeerida oma telefone nõudlikumate ülesannete jaoks, mida näitab ilmekalt näiteks tänapäevaste iPhone'ide ja Androidi telefonide tehniliste näitajate võrdlemine. Kuigi õuna esindajatel on paberil veidi kehvem riistvara, nii et Android on seevastu lüüasaamise äärel. Tegelikkuses pole asi paberil andmetes.

Huvitavat erinevust näeme peamiselt operatiivmälus (RAM). Kui me võrdleme näiteks põhilist Samsung Galaxy S22 s iPhone 13, mis on samuti saadaval ligikaudu sama hinnaga, näeme operatsioonimälu vallas üsna põhimõttelist erinevust. Kui Samsungi mudel peidab endas 8 GB muutmälu, siis iPhone saab hakkama vaid 4 GB muutmäluga. Lisaks on selle teemaga seotud ka rakenduste sulgemine, mis peaks vabastama töömälu ja omamoodi säästma. Androidi operatsioonisüsteemiga telefonides on seetõttu käepärane nupp kõigi hetkel avatud rakenduste sulgemiseks. Aga miks pole iOS-il midagi sarnast? Eriti kui võtta arvesse asjaolu, et sellel alal kaotab ta isegi oma konkurentsile.

Miks pole iOS-il nuppu kõigi rakenduste sulgemiseks?

Tuleb arvestada, et mõlemad süsteemid töötavad veidi erinevalt. Kui Androidis võib operatsioonimälu puhastamisest mõnel juhul kasu olla, siis iOS saab ilma millegi sarnaseta hakkama. Lisaks ei lülita Apple'i kasutajad isegi üksikuid rakendusi välja ja lasevad neil kõigil lihtsalt taustal töötada. Aga miks? Apple’i operatsioonisüsteemi puhul lähevad need automaatselt unerežiimi ega ammu isegi akust energiat. Lisaks on see ökonoomsem lahendus kui äppide pidev välja- ja seejärel sisselülitamine – lihtsalt nende sisselülitamine võtab rohkem energiat kui rakenduse taustale jätmine. Mainitud uni/suspensioon toimub praktiliselt kohe pärast seda, kui me selle keskkonnast lahkume.

Sel põhjusel ei taha Apple isegi, et Apple'i kasutajad rakendusi üldse välja lülitaksid. Lõpuks on see üsna loogiline. Nagu eespool mainisime, teeme nende väljalülitamisega pigem endale kahju. Antud äppide uuesti sisselülitamiseks kulutaksime palju rohkem energiat ja tulemus oleks vastupidine. Sama lugu on ka töömäluga. Kui kõnealune tarkvara on taustal peatatud, siis loogiliselt võttes ei kasuta see isegi telefoni ressursse – vähemalt mitte sellisel määral.

Rakenduste sulgemine iOS-is

Apple'i poolt kinnitatud

Varem on seda probleemi kommenteerinud ka ettevõtte tarkvaratehnika asepresident Craig Federighi, kelle sõnul on täiesti ebavajalik pidevalt jooksvaid rakendusi välja lülitada. Nagu eespool mainitud, lähevad taustal olevad talveunerežiimi ega tarbi praktiliselt midagi, mistõttu on nende pidev väljalülitamine täiesti ebavajalik. Võime seda võtta kui vastust meie algsele küsimusele. iOS operatsioonisüsteemi jaoks oleks mainitud nupp kõigi rakenduste lõpetamiseks lihtsalt täiesti ebavajalik.

.